What does it mean to “play the victim?” “playing the victim” entails someone who is exaggerating or fabricating an event, experience, or emotion to portray themselves as a victim in the situation, when in reality they are not a victim. Playing the victim is a tactic that lots of people use, consciously or subconsciously. Playing involves some level of exaggeration, fabrication, or manipulation. Playing the victim means consistently portraying oneself as the unjustly treated party in a situation, avoiding responsibility, and seeking sympathy from others. Feeling and recognizing that you are a victim of abuse, trauma, crime, or another circumstance is different than playing the victim.
